Hunter Yoder Inks Deal with TiLube Honda Racing

Former GEICO/ Factory Connection amateur standout Hunter Yoder announced on Instagram today that he is turning pro and has signed with TiLube Honda Racing and will make his Monster Energy Supercross debut at the 250SX East Region opener in Minneapolis on Feb. 19.

“Super excited to announce I’ll be racing for @tilubehondaracing in the 250sx East coast @supercrosslive series! Been putting in a lot of work this off season and I can’t wait to go racing! #rookieszn

Yoder, who missed Loretta’s in 2020 due to COVID-19 concerns, earned one of his two titles at the Ranch with the Factory Connection Honda team in 2019, winning 450 B Limited. He then signed a deal with the Phoenix Honda Racing team for 2021.

The California native returned to Loretta’s in 2021 and finished fifth in Open Pro Sport and 250 Pro Sport.

Grant Harlan and Izaih Clark are also expected to race for the team on the East Region.
